Transaction 43766ab42224387a45504d756834968c75b9b22d031210876b41e3fc3a025efd
1 Input
1 Output
-
43766ab42224387a45504d756834968c75b9b22d031210876b41e3fc3a025efd:0
- value
- 81702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68080604bf84a317f5e3791e20b7a0bc77a2e061 OP_EQUAL
- address
- 3BB5oye6jyX87Nsh1SCveYVYnwiA1ikyDm